Designing A Secure Network With Dynamic DNS Principles

Dynamic DNS (DDNS) is a service designed to enable individuals to connect to a device with an altering IP address via a static domain name. DDNS adds a layer of dynamism: whenever the IP address modifications, the DNS document automatically updates, maintaining constant access factors no matter of IP fluctuations.

An essential application of DDNS is its combination with routers, allowing customers to configure their network settings directly from the router's console. Many contemporary routers included integrated assistance for popular DDNS services. By setting up DDNS on the router, individuals can make certain that their network's external IP address is appropriately mapped to a domain. This method is commonly less complex than by hand configuring DDNS on private gadgets. Router suppliers often offer assistance on DBA settings, enabling individuals to conveniently navigate the process.

Packages regularly offered by DDNS providers can differ, with some offering a mix of free and paid services. Free dynamic DNS hosting might come with restrictions such as fewer functions or the need for regular account activity to keep the domain energetic. Users seeking a more thorough service might select paid DDNS solutions, which usually give extra advantages, such as enhanced security protocols, ensured uptime, and priority assistance.
